I had some sunchokes in my CSA bag last week and somehow I thought they would be very good in a stew with some beer. Then I remembered how much we liked the Beer-bathed Seitan Stew from Vegan Eats World, so I made that, with sunchokes instead of turnips. It was awesome, even better than the turnip version. Sunchokes really do pair well with beer.
